Program Director Dana Lashley and Global Education Office staff will share information and answer questions about the '24 summer study abroad program in Cape Town, South Africa. 

The Cape Town summer program mixes classroom instruction and hands-on service learning. 

Students will take two 3-credit courses and one 1-credit course:

  • CHEM 361 Global Infectious Diseases (3 credits);
  • AFST 306/HIST 212 Topics in Africana Studies/Topics in History: From Rhodes to Mandela and from Apartheid to Aids (3 credits); and
  • AFST 306 Topics in Africana Studies: Survival isiXhosa (1 credit).

The Cape Town program can include excursions to locations such as Robben Island, the site of Nelson Mandela's imprisonment, Table Mountain, Cape Point, Cape of Good Hope, and museums and historic sites in and around Cape Town.
